This natural Orthoceras fossil slab features multiple fossilised Orthoceras specimens preserved within a polished stone matrix. Orthoceras were ancient marine cephalopods that lived approximately 400 million years ago during the Devonian period, making these fossils a fascinating glimpse into prehistoric ocean life.

This slab showcases the distinctive long, straight shells of Orthoceras, beautifully revealed through careful cutting and polishing. These specimens are popular with fossil collectors, natural history enthusiasts, educators, and anyone looking for a unique display piece.

Interesting Fact
Orthoceras were distant relatives of modern squid and nautiluses. Their long conical shells helped them navigate the ancient seas long before the age of dinosaurs.
